Rehearsals: The Elmhurst Choral Union rehearses on Monday evenings from 7:00 to 9:30 p.m. in Irion Hall on the campus of Elmhurst College, 190 Prospect in Elmhurst (see our Directions page for details). There is on-campus parking (a nice big lot on the north side of Alexander), but it's not right next to Irion Hall, so plan an extra five minutes to walk to the building.
During the final week before a performance, we hold a Saturday afternoon rehearsal in Elmhurst College's beautiful Hammerschmidt Chapel. Concerts are held in Hammerschmidt Chapel at 3:00 p.m. on a Sunday (early December and early Spring).
Auditions: Membership is open to singers with previous choral experience and/or the ability to read music. You will have a brief, low-key audition with our director to determine vocal strength and range. Please be prepared to vocalize and sing one prepared song (in any language) or The Star-Spangled Banner. At this time, we especially need basses and tenors.
Auditions for the winter-spring 2012 session will be Monday, January 30.
Membership Requirements: To maintain a high quality performance with professional orchestra and soloists, members are financially responsible for 5 tickets to each concert and pay an annual membership fee. You will need to purchase a copy of the score, available at rehearsals. Contact us if you have questions.
If you are new, you may sit in at the first rehearsal before deciding to join. Singers may join us no later than the second rehearsal of a semester.
